Ever found yourself staring at a 3 AM Slack notification because your dev team flagged a security breach? Yeah, us too. Now multiply that by the thousands of containers running in your environment. Sounds like your laptop fan during a 4K render—whirrrr, right? But what if I told you the real villain isn’t just hackers—it’s unpatched vulnerabilities hiding deep within your containers.
In this guide, we’ll explore the world of vulnerability scanning for containers, why it’s critical for modern cybersecurity, and how you can keep your data fortress impenetrable. Spoiler alert: We’ll cover actionable steps, share terrible advice (because honesty sells), and even drop some vintage Tamagotchi wisdom. Let’s dive in!
Table of Contents
- Introduction
- Key Takeaways
- Why Container Vulnerabilities Are Your Worst Nightmare
- Step-by-Step Guide to Setting Up Vulnerability Scanning
- Tips & Best Practices for Effective Scanning
- Real-World Examples That Prove It Works
- Frequently Asked Questions
- Conclusion
Key Takeaways
- Containers are everywhere—but so are their vulnerabilities.
- Vulnerability scanning tools identify risks before bad actors exploit them.
- Automated scans reduce manual workload and improve consistency.
- Best practices include integrating scanning into CI/CD pipelines.
- Prioritize remediation based on risk severity.
Why Container Vulnerabilities Are Your Worst Nightmare

Let’s face it, containers have revolutionized software development—but with great power comes great responsibility (and tons of headaches). Did you know that 75% of organizations experienced a container-related breach last year alone? These lightweight, portable units may streamline deployments, but they’re also riddled with potential entry points for attackers.
Here’s a confessional fail moment from yours truly: Back in 2020, my team deployed an app without scanning its base images. Fast forward two weeks—a malicious library in the image opened the door for credential theft. Lesson learned? Never skip vulnerability checks. Ever.
Step-by-Step Guide to Setting Up Vulnerability Scanning
Optimist You: “Follow these tips!” Grumpy You: “Ugh, fine—but only if coffee’s involved.” Let’s get started:
Step 1: Choose the Right Tool
Tools like Trivy, Anchore, Aqua Security, and Clair dominate the market. Each has unique strengths; pick one aligned with your tech stack.
Step 2: Integrate Scanning Into Your CI/CD Pipeline
Why wait until deployment when you can catch issues earlier? Add scanning scripts to Jenkins, GitHub Actions, or GitLab CI/CD workflows.
Step 3: Scan Base Images
Base images often carry outdated packages. Always scan them before building new container images.
Step 4: Automate Everything
Routine scans save time and sanity. Schedule nightly scans using cron jobs or orchestration platforms like Kubernetes.
Step 5: Generate Detailed Reports
Reports help prioritize fixes. Look for tools offering clear insights about CVEs (Common Vulnerabilities and Exposures).
Tips & Best Practices for Effective Scanning
- Avoid This Terrible Tip: “Just patch everything later.” Delayed patches lead to sleepless nights and angry clients.
- Keep your scanning tool updated regularly—it needs love too!
- Adopt a ‘shift-left’ approach to security by embedding scans as early as possible in development cycles.
- Prioritize high-risk vulnerabilities first. Not all threats are created equal.
- Educate your team. Human error remains the #1 cause of breaches.
Real-World Examples That Prove It Works
Rant Alert: If I hear another company blame “legacy systems” for poor cybersecurity hygiene, I might scream louder than dial-up internet. Stop making excuses!
Case Study 1: A retail giant reduced container breaches by 60% after implementing automated scanning powered by Aqua Security. Their secret? Early integration into CI/CD pipelines.
Case Study 2: An e-commerce platform fixed 80% of critical vulnerabilities within months thanks to nightly Trivy scans across all clusters. They slept better—and avoided PR nightmares.
Frequently Asked Questions
What is vulnerability scanning for containers?
It’s the process of identifying security flaws within container images, helping teams mitigate potential threats.
How often should I run scans?
Daily or weekly scans work best, depending on your deployment frequency.
Can’t I rely on firewalls instead?
Nope. Firewalls protect networks, but vulnerabilities inside containers need proactive detection.
Which tools integrate well with Kubernetes?
Anchore, NeuVector, and Falco are top choices for Kubernetes environments.
Conclusion
If there’s one thing this post drilled home (besides the importance of coffee), it’s that vulnerability scanning for containers isn’t optional—it’s essential. With cybercriminals evolving daily, staying ahead means embracing automation, education, and relentless vigilance.
Like a Tamagotchi, your digital defenses require constant care. So strap in, scan smarter, and keep those containers secure.


